Transaction 21022308899ee7f679ff94b8bbc92ce246f2595de7b3b2f006e913af89fa7388

1 Input
2 Outputs
  • 21022308899ee7f679ff94b8bbc92ce246f2595de7b3b2f006e913af89fa7388:0
  • value  10537385
    address  17cbucJNknNcETyheYHAusbXgeJ3ZDp6eB
  • 21022308899ee7f679ff94b8bbc92ce246f2595de7b3b2f006e913af89fa7388:1
  • value  16547282
    address  12AG7B2DAcAUZ5s4MF9CMAsNz717HLo5D3